The core difference between Odrive and Inoreader lies in their functionalities; Odrive is a straightforward CMS ideal for small teams needing quick access and editing capabilities, while Inoreader excels in content curation through an advanced RSS reader with modern integrations. Odrive is best suited for small teams or businesses looking for a simple website management solution, whereas Inoreader is ideal for teams focused on efficient content consumption and organization.
